Zawaj Ala El-Tareeqa El-Mahalleya is an intriguing piece from 1978 that dives into the complexities of romance within the backdrop of everyday life. The film, with its modest pacing, captures the essence of local love stories, allowing the audience to feel the weight of cultural expectations. There's this raw, almost nostalgic atmosphere that permeates the scenes, making it distinct in its portrayal of character emotions without relying heavily on grand gestures. The performances, while not overly dramatic, are sincere, adding layers to the narrative. It's one of those films that resonates differently depending on your own experiences, drawing you in with its subtle charm.
